The payment calendar is an operational plan, a table of receipts and disbursements of funds for any period, with details by day, week or month. It helps you see at what point you may run out of money so that you can arrange in advance with customers and suppliers to postpone dates or change payment terms.
As an interactive report, it shows you the automatically generated cash flow forecast versus actual documents for the specified period and allows you to add certain documents for more correct cash balances.

To start using the "Payment Calendar" feature, please check the settings, go to Administration → Money → put a check mark in the field "Cash Flow Forecasting"

There are two ways to plan cash flow:
- "by orders" — based on orders from the customer and supplier. The following documents are used to plan the cash flow "by orders" → Customer Order, Purchase Order, Proforma Invoice, Proforma Invoice Received.
- "according to planning documents" — creation of planning documents, the following documents are used → Money Payments (Plan), Money Receipts (Plan).
